Health secretary Wes SteetIng saId the deal marks the fIrst step Health Secretary Wes StreetIng saId the deal marks the fIrst step In Future ProofIng The Nhs. But the BrItIsh MedIcal AssocIatIon has warned of further actIon If pay does not contInue to match InflatIon. Our Health EdItor Hugh pym has thIs report. It began In march last Year. StrIkIng JunIor Doctors on PIcket LInes In england and demandIng a Pay RIse of 35 to be phased In, whIch they saId should compensate for InflatIon over more than a decade. What do we want . Pay restoratIon when do we want It . Now some talks took place wIth the conservatIve government, but that dIdnt stop 11 rounds of strIkes over a total of 44 days. Soon after the electIon, the Labour Government made an Increased pay offer, whIch the Doctors UnIon, the bma, put to members and they voted to accept. Pacific, im Ana Cabrera reporting from New York. We begin with the Breaking News out of ukraine. President zelenskyy confirming that a russian Missile Strike killed at least 41 people and injured 180 more making it one of the deadly strikes since the war began. The ukrainian officials say the attack in the central town of poltava hitting a military Training Facility ....
